Glossary of Terms “Manner of” – a work of art done in the style of the artist but which, in our opinion, is from a later date or by another hand “After” – a copy of a work of art by the artist, which could be done during the artist’s life time or thereafter. “Attributed to” – a work of art which, in our opinion, is likely to be by the artist. Note that this does not supersede the fact that all items are sold as-is. Artist’s name in title – if we list an artist’s name in the title without qualification, it is our opinion that the work of art was executed by that artist. Note that this does not supersede the fact that all items are sold as-is. “Style” – any item which is in the style of, but not created by or during the period of, the qualified term. “Style” could be used for a variety of items, for example a Chippendale-style dresser would be a dresser in the Chippendale style but created later, or a Picasso-style painting could be any painting created in the artist’s style at any time. “ozt” – troy ounces “ctw” – carats total weight 2.
